发明名称 Water dispersible collagen and a process for its preparation
摘要 The invention comprises hydrogen peroxideconditioned, water dispersible collagen. Waterdispersible collagen may be prepared by treating a collagen-containing material with hydrogen peroxide to condition it, acidifying the conditioned collagen to a pH not above 3.0, and comminuting the acidified, conditioned collagen. The collagen-containing material is conditioned by treatment with a 0.5 to 10.0% solution of hydrogen peroxide. The conditioning may take place at a temperature of approximately 37 DEG C. and may take about 1 to 2 hours. The conditioned collagen may be acidified to a pH of 2.0 to 3.0 e.g. with hydrochloric acid, at a temperature of approximately 37 DEG C. The comminuted collagen may be treated at a pH of up to 4.0 and a temperature of 1 DEG to 60 DEG C. or the comminuted collagen may be maintained at a pH of up to 4.0 and a temperature of 0 DEG to 60 DEG C. for up to 8 hours, e.g. at a pH of 1.0 to 1.5. The collagen-containing material may be skin e.g. pigskin, hide, tendons, or ossein. Food may be coated with a film formed from hydrogen peroxide-conditioned, water-dispersible collagen, and the film may be tanned. Tanning agents are vegetable wattle, chestnut tannins, oak bark, quebracho extract and spruce extracts; sodium dichromate, chromium sulphate, chrome alum, and aluminium sulphate; formaldehlde, sulphonic chromates and phenolic synthetic tars.ALSO:foods, e.g. pieces of meat or sausage, may be coated by dipping in a liquid dispersion of a hydrogen peroxide-conditioned water dispersible collagen. The coating may be tanned using vegetable wattle, chestnut tannins, oak bark, quebracho extract and spruce extracts; sodium dichromate, chromium sulphate, chrome alum and aluminium sulphate; formaldehyde, sulphonic chromates and phenolic synthetic tans. The collagen product may also be used as heat-coagulable food binders.
